About Middesk

Middesk is a San Francisco-based company that provides a platform for businesses to verify the legitimacy of other businesses. The company was founded in 2018 by Kyle Mack and Kurt Ruppel. Middesk's platform uses machine learning algorithms to analyze public data and provide insights into a company's legitimacy, such as its legal structure, ownership, and financial health. The company's customers include banks, insurance companies, and other businesses that need to verify the legitimacy of their partners and vendors.
